Persistent notification for user when their post is held for approval

To combat spam, I’ve set the “approve post count” setting to 1, which requires every new user’s first post to be approved by a moderator. However, I’ve noticed a recurring issue: many users are not noticing the one-time pop-up notification that informs them their post is under review.

As a result, I’ve observed several genuine new users reposting the same content multiple times, likely out of frustration and confusion, unaware that their original post is pending approval.

While we could argue that users should pay closer attention to notifications, the reality is that people often click through pop-ups without fully reading them.

Instead of relying on a one-off dismissable notification, an improved solution would be to implement a persistent UI indicator that clearly shows the user their post was successfully submitted and is currently awaiting approval. This would reduce duplicate posts and alleviate frustration.